Output 62e3922cda2f45cb44e90d839d7927526ec808d6f1617d70f7fb45db8dbfc8b2:594

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cac7f25f2740e7ee9cbb8deeb8d3e1d01be1252dd25331edfeb8ebaede7d8742
address
bc1petrlyhe8grn7a89m3hht35lp6qd7zffd6ffnrm07hr46ahnasapqyn408j
transaction
62e3922cda2f45cb44e90d839d7927526ec808d6f1617d70f7fb45db8dbfc8b2
confirmations
104582
spent
true